Off the top of my head, I'm not sure where Thermals fall in the Munitions tree, but it's probably at least the 3rd box. However, I highly recommend that you get at least Techniques IV so that you have 7 experimentation points. Without it you'll only have 2 experimentation points, and yes experimentation does matter for grenades. The difference will be several hundreds of points for damage and quite a bit for accuracy/range.


To be perfectly honest though, you'll be much better off taking the money you'd spend to grind weaponsmith and spending itto buy grenades instead. Shop around for the best deal you can find...there are plenty of WS in the galaxy, and they all charge different prices. If you're short on cash, get some Medium harvestors and a stack of power and harvest some good steel. Even if you sell it for only 3 cpu, you'll make more than enough in a week to buy plenty of grenades...and you'll save yourself a ton of aggravation and monotonous(sp?)grinding.


Finally, I'm not sure when the CU will go live, but it will probably be at least another month or two, maybe longer.


Hope this helps.

Ask who ever told you that assembly & experimentation don't matter much why we pay the prices we do for the SEA's. Those little points make all the difference in the world!


On top of not having your experimentation & assembly points, you'll need to find quality materials. Even if you have your points, with trash material, all you can make is trash.


For thermals & their components, you'll need: Amorphous Gemstone, Carbonate Ore, Copper, Crism Siliclastic Ore, Inert Gas, Low Grade Ore, Metal, Polymer, Radioactive, Reactive Gas, Steel, & Thoranium Steel.


The Thoranium Steel will be the fun one. It's an uncommon spawn, and the caps on it's stats are so low that no one wants it for anything but grinding weaponsmith, making mines, orfor makingthermals.

Well without experimentation, and probably crappy resource (because the best are very expensiveand hard to find), you can probably make 1200 max damage Thermals, while the ones you buy are around 1825+ max damage. That will rea lly make a difference, and you can even buy Grenade PuP's to add 650 extra to that (with the 1825+ that is) so that will make them 2500+ grenades. If you do that with the 1200'syou'llget 1600+ grenades with the PuP's in them. So I'd say buy the Thermals much cheaper and faster.
